《SQL Server 2008查询性能优化精粹》提供了一种直接的故障排除方法,用于识别和解决存储过程和查询的性能问题,强调了每个章节专注于不同性能问题的实用方法。重点放在你可以立即在日常工作中使用的实际技巧上。每个主题区域都强调了SQL Server 2008的功能、技巧和窍门。
SQL Server 2008查询性能优化精粹
相关推荐
SQL Server 2008 查询性能优化指南
本书阐述了处理查询性能问题的工具和方法,涵盖了数据库系统中常见的性能瓶颈表现、成因和解决办法,从硬件到查询优化、索引设计和数据库管理等。书中还总结了最佳实践清单,帮助读者养成良好的编程习惯,构建高性能数据库系统。
SQLServer
2
2024-05-15
SQL Server 2008 查询性能优化(二)
本部分是《SQL Server 2008 Query Performance Tuning Distilled》一书的第二个,共包含三个部分。请下载全部三个部分并确保文件名保持不变,以便成功解压。
SQLServer
2
2024-05-30
SQL Server 2008查询性能优化技巧
由于网站上传限制及本书大小限制,本书分四卷。
SQLServer
0
2024-08-04
深入解析 SQL Server 2008 查询性能优化
深入解析 SQL Server 2008 查询性能优化
本部分将着重探讨一些高级技巧,助您进一步提升 SQL Server 2008 数据库的查询效率。
1. 索引优化进阶
深入分析查询语句,识别潜在的索引使用问题。
探索非聚集索引、筛选索引和包含列等高级索引技术。
学习如何利用索引提示来引导查询优化器选择最佳执行计划。
2. 统计信息管理
了解统计信息对于查询优化器的重要性。
掌握更新统计信息的时机和方法,确保其准确性。
探讨如何利用统计信息来改善查询计划的选择。
3. 执行计划分析与调优
学习如何解读 SQL Server 2008 的执行计划。
识别执行计划中的性能瓶颈,例如索引扫描、排序操作等。
运用查询提示、索引调整等手段优化执行计划。
4. 其他优化技巧
合理使用临时表和表变量,避免不必要的磁盘 I/O 操作。
优化数据库设计,例如规范化、反规范化等。
利用数据库服务器的硬件资源,例如增加内存、优化磁盘配置等。
通过学习和实践这些高级优化技巧,您可以显著提升 SQL Server 2008 数据库的查询性能,为您的应用程序提供更快速、更流畅的用户体验。
SQLServer
2
2024-05-28
SQL Server 2008查询性能优化技巧详解
《SQL Server 2008查询性能优化》是一本中文扫描版的书籍,详细讲述了如何优化SQL Server 2008中的查询性能。尽管是扫描版,但文件清晰度高,内容丰富,适合需要深入了解此版本数据库优化的读者。
SQLServer
0
2024-08-11
SQL Server 2008查询性能优化技巧(原版英文)
本书详细阐述了SQL Server数据库系统优化的各种方法和技巧,通过丰富的实例涵盖了从硬件瓶颈到查询、索引设计以及数据库管理的方方面面。适合开发人员和数据库管理员阅读,提供宝典式的最佳实践列表。
SQLServer
1
2024-07-31
SQL SERVER 2008实战开发精粹
掌握企业级数据开发利器,征服大数据与数据分析
深入浅出,精讲SQL SERVER 2008 开发技巧
案例驱动,实战演练企业级项目
助力数据驱动决策,提升企业竞争力
SQLServer
3
2024-05-19
SQL Server Reporting Services 2008 精粹
深入剖析 SQL Server Reporting Services 2008 的方方面面,涵盖报表设计、部署、自动化和自定义。
SQLServer
2
2024-05-25
SQL Server 查询性能优化
提升 SQL Server 查询效率
通过优化查询,可以显著提升 SQL Server 数据库的性能和响应速度。以下是一些常用的优化方法:
1. 索引优化
创建合适的索引:针对经常用于 WHERE 子句、JOIN 条件和 ORDER BY 子句的列创建索引,可以加速数据检索。
避免过度索引:过多的索引会增加数据库维护成本,并可能降低写入性能。
2. 查询语句优化
避免使用 SELECT *:只选择必要的列,减少数据传输量。
使用参数化查询:避免 SQL 注入,并提高查询效率。
优化 JOIN 操作:选择合适的 JOIN 类型,并确保 JOIN 条件上有索引。
3. 数据库设计优化
选择合适的数据类型:使用正确的数据类型可以节省存储空间,并提高查询效率。
规范化数据库:避免数据冗余,并确保数据一致性。
4. 服务器配置优化
分配足够的内存:确保 SQL Server 拥有足够的内存来缓存数据和执行查询。
配置合适的磁盘 I/O:使用高速磁盘或 RAID 阵列来提高数据读取和写入速度。
SQLServer
6
2024-04-30